Telemetria w Naza v2 + Taranis

FC - wykorzystujące sprzęt firmy DJI

Moderatorzy: moderatorzy2014, moderatorzy

Awatar użytkownika
matulekpl
Posty: 2175
Rejestracja: piątek 16 paź 2015, 16:48
Lokalizacja: Wejherowo

Re: Telemetria w Naza v2 + Taranis

Post autor: matulekpl »

Kolejna sprawa:)
Tak bedzie wyglądało poprawne połączenie do zaprogramowania?
Obrazek


Wysłane z iPhone za pomocą Tapatalk
Ostatnio zmieniony czwartek 11 lut 2016, 08:33 przez matulekpl, łącznie zmieniany 1 raz.
Moje zabawki: Syma X5SW ORANGE + TX MOD | Syma X8C MODDED | DJI F450 NaZa-GULL - RIP. | TBS Discovery NAZA-GuLL | DJI Phantom 3 ADV - SPRZEDANY | DJI Phantom 4 PRO
WWW/BLOG: www.matulekpl.com | Kanał YouTube: Youtube | Foto: Flickr
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

matulekpl pisze:Kolejna sprawa:)
Tak bedzie wyglądało poprawne połączenie do zaprogramowania?
http://i984.photobucket.com/albums/ae32 ... 164499.jpg
Ej no, takie podstawy to juz sobie sam chyba jestes w stanie wygooglac ;-)
Awatar użytkownika
matulekpl
Posty: 2175
Rejestracja: piątek 16 paź 2015, 16:48
Lokalizacja: Wejherowo

Re: Telemetria w Naza v2 + Taranis

Post autor: matulekpl »

Ale jak popsuje - kupujesz nowe:)


Wysłane z iPhone za pomocą Tapatalk
Moje zabawki: Syma X5SW ORANGE + TX MOD | Syma X8C MODDED | DJI F450 NaZa-GULL - RIP. | TBS Discovery NAZA-GuLL | DJI Phantom 3 ADV - SPRZEDANY | DJI Phantom 4 PRO
WWW/BLOG: www.matulekpl.com | Kanał YouTube: Youtube | Foto: Flickr
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

matulekpl pisze:Ale jak popsuje - kupujesz nowe:)
Nie filozuj, bo Ci wystawie rachunek za bibloteki :-P
Awatar użytkownika
matulekpl
Posty: 2175
Rejestracja: piątek 16 paź 2015, 16:48
Lokalizacja: Wejherowo

Re: Telemetria w Naza v2 + Taranis

Post autor: matulekpl »

pawelsky proszę o podpowiedź.
tak mam wszystko podłączyć??? - przerobilem lekko Twój schemat:
Obrazek

pytanie jak teraz opisać w kodzie te wejścia i wyjścia?
i po co jest D2 i D3? jest potrzebne czy nie?

mógłbyś przerobić mi ten swój kod ze strony http://www.rcgroups.com/forums/showpost ... stcount=36 tak aby pasował pod mój moduł?
Moje zabawki: Syma X5SW ORANGE + TX MOD | Syma X8C MODDED | DJI F450 NaZa-GULL - RIP. | TBS Discovery NAZA-GuLL | DJI Phantom 3 ADV - SPRZEDANY | DJI Phantom 4 PRO
WWW/BLOG: www.matulekpl.com | Kanał YouTube: Youtube | Foto: Flickr
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

matulekpl pisze:pawelsky proszę o podpowiedź.
tak mam wszystko podłączyć??? - przerobilem lekko Twój schemat:
Naza OK, S.Port nie, na schemacie w pierwszym poscie tego watka (jak i w zipie z biblioteka do telemetrii) znajdziesz informacje jak i gdzie podlaczyc S.Port.
http://www.rcgroups.com/forums/showthread.php?t=2245978
matulekpl pisze:pytanie jak teraz opisać w kodzie te wejścia i wyjścia?
Tak na poczatek to https://www.arduino.cc/en/Tutorial/HomePage, ale tak naprawde to wystarczy przyjrzec sie uwaznie przykladom do moich bibliotek, nic tak naprawde nie musisz opisywac
matulekpl pisze:i po co jest D2 i D3? jest potrzebne czy nie?
Pitch i roll. Raczej nie bedzie Ci potrzebne.
matulekpl pisze:mógłbyś przerobić mi ten swój kod ze strony http://www.rcgroups.com/forums/showpost ... stcount=36 tak aby pasował pod mój moduł?
Nidyrydy. Kombinuj, ucz sie. W przykladach do bibliotek masz praktycznie wszystko co powinienes wiedziec zeby polaczyc jedno z drugim.
Awatar użytkownika
matulekpl
Posty: 2175
Rejestracja: piątek 16 paź 2015, 16:48
Lokalizacja: Wejherowo

Telemetria w Naza v2 + Taranis

Post autor: matulekpl »

No ok wszystko pięknie ładnie ale ten schemat co dałem jest wlasnie z pliku zip od nazadecoder. Poza tym w tym kodzie gotowym do NAZY używasz Portów Serial a to chyba wlasnie są te porty?

Edyta: juz chyba wiem o co kaman. Niedoczytalem jak zdefiniować te seriale. Juz wiem chyba:)

Wysłane z iPhone za pomocą Tapatalk
Moje zabawki: Syma X5SW ORANGE + TX MOD | Syma X8C MODDED | DJI F450 NaZa-GULL - RIP. | TBS Discovery NAZA-GuLL | DJI Phantom 3 ADV - SPRZEDANY | DJI Phantom 4 PRO
WWW/BLOG: www.matulekpl.com | Kanał YouTube: Youtube | Foto: Flickr
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

matulekpl pisze:No ok wszystko pięknie ładnie ale ten schemat co dałem jest wlasnie z pliku zip od nazadecoder.
A spojrzales dokad prowadzi link ktory podalem w poprzednim poscie? :-)
pawelsky pisze:na schemacie w pierwszym poscie tego watka (jak i w zipie z biblioteka do telemetrii) znajdziesz informacje jak i gdzie podlaczyc S.Port.
http://www.rcgroups.com/forums/showthread.php?t=2245978
Za raczke prowadzil nie bede, musisz ogarnac to sam, poradzisz sobie.
Awatar użytkownika
matulekpl
Posty: 2175
Rejestracja: piątek 16 paź 2015, 16:48
Lokalizacja: Wejherowo

Re: Telemetria w Naza v2 + Taranis

Post autor: matulekpl »

czyli tak powinno być ok?:
Obrazek

No i kod:
#include "NazaDecoderLib.h"
#include "FrSkySportSensorGps.h"
#include "FrSkySportSensorRpm.h"
#include "FrSkySportSensorVario.h"
#include "FrSkySportSingleWireSerial.h"
#include "FrSkySportTelemetry.h"
#include "SoftwareSerial.h"

FrSkySportSensorGps gps;
FrSkySportSensorRpm rpm;
FrSkySportSensorVario vario;
FrSkySportTelemetry telemetry;

void setup()
{
Serial1.begin(115200);
telemetry.begin(FrSkySportSingleWireSerial::SOFT_SERIAL_PIN_2, &gps, &rpm, &vario);
}

void loop()
{
if(Serial1.available())
{
if(NazaDecoder.decode(Serial1.read()) == NAZA_MESSAGE_GPS)
{
gps.setData(NazaDecoder.getLat(), NazaDecoder.getLon(),
NazaDecoder.getGpsAlt(), NazaDecoder.getSpeed(), NazaDecoder.getCog(),
NazaDecoder.getYear(), NazaDecoder.getMonth(), NazaDecoder.getDay(),
NazaDecoder.getHour(), NazaDecoder.getMinute(), NazaDecoder.getSecond());
rpm.setData(0.0, NazaDecoder.getNumSat(), NazaDecoder.getFixType());
vario.setData(NazaDecoder.getGpsAlt(), NazaDecoder.getGpsVsi());
}
}

telemetry.send();
}
No i odblokowałem linijkę #define ATTITUDE_SENSING_DISABLED

czy Serial1 jest ok? jak to będzie identyfikowane?

zmienione na Serial
Moje zabawki: Syma X5SW ORANGE + TX MOD | Syma X8C MODDED | DJI F450 NaZa-GULL - RIP. | TBS Discovery NAZA-GuLL | DJI Phantom 3 ADV - SPRZEDANY | DJI Phantom 4 PRO
WWW/BLOG: www.matulekpl.com | Kanał YouTube: Youtube | Foto: Flickr
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

pawelsky pisze:poradzisz sobie.
A nie mowilem? Brawo! :-)
Awatar użytkownika
Spenser
Posty: 107
Rejestracja: sobota 23 sty 2016, 20:44
Lokalizacja: NL

Re: Telemetria w Naza v2 + Taranis

Post autor: Spenser »

Tak więc ja też poradziłem sobie z wpięciem tego sensora (przyszedł przed chwilą) :)
Obrazek

Gdy wyszukałem sensory, znajduje mi tylko napięcie całej baterii, nie poszczególnych cel. Dodam że kiedyś coś tam grzebałem w aparaturze i usunąłem chyba sensor 3, bo znajduje sensory 1, 2 i 4. Załączam zdjęcia przed i po podpięciu modułu:

Obrazek

Obrazek

No i co to jest to RxBt 5.2V? :)
Ogólnie brakuje mi parametru Cell. Dzięki za wskazówki jak to dodać.
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

Spenser pisze:No i co to jest to RxBt 5.2V? :)
Napiecie zasilania odbiornika
Spenser pisze:Ogólnie brakuje mi parametru Cell. Dzięki za wskazówki jak to dodać.
http://rc-fpv.pl/viewtopic.php?p=436425#p436425
Awatar użytkownika
Spenser
Posty: 107
Rejestracja: sobota 23 sty 2016, 20:44
Lokalizacja: NL

Re: Telemetria w Naza v2 + Taranis

Post autor: Spenser »

Czyli mam rozumieć, że FLVSS przesyła jedynie parametr Cels, a resztę liczy aparatura? (chcę potwierdzić czy nic nie miałem nagrzebane w tej telemetrii)
Jeśli chodzi o parametr RxBt 5.2V to napięcie w aparaturze mam 7.2V obecnie a naładowana na full ma ponad 8V. A RxBt jest chyba takie samo cały czas. Sprawdzałem woltomierzem baterię i kalibrowałem w aparaturze.
Awatar użytkownika
pawelsky
Posty: 9763
Rejestracja: środa 19 mar 2014, 02:03
Lokalizacja: Polska
Kontakt:

Re: Telemetria w Naza v2 + Taranis

Post autor: pawelsky »

Spenser pisze:Czyli mam rozumieć, że FLVSS przesyła jedynie parametr Cels, a resztę liczy aparatura?
FLVSS przesyla informacje o kazdej celi z osobna. OpenTX 2.1.x domyslnie wyswietla tylko napiecie laczne. Instrukcje jak uzyskac napiecie na poszczegolnych celach dostales.
Spenser pisze:Jeśli chodzi o parametr RxBt 5.2V to napięcie w aparaturze mam 7.2V
A co ma napiecie w aparaturze do napiecia zasilania odbiornika? :-)
Awatar użytkownika
Spenser
Posty: 107
Rejestracja: sobota 23 sty 2016, 20:44
Lokalizacja: NL

Re: Telemetria w Naza v2 + Taranis

Post autor: Spenser »

pawelsky pisze:A co ma napiecie w aparaturze do napiecia zasilania odbiornika?
Pewnie nic :) Skoro jest stałe i nie mam na nie wpływu, to niech sobie tam zostanie.

Jeśli chodzi o baterię, to dobrze to zrobiłem?
Cel0 cela z najniższym napięciem w danym momencie ustawiona na Lowest
Cel1 cela 1 z wyświetlacza (jako Cell index 1)
Cel2 cela 2 z wyświetlacza (Cell index 2)

/Edit: Dobra już to ogarnąłem - dodałem sobie Cel3 :) Gubię się bo nie mam czasu, zwolniłem się z pracy żeby polatać bo tylko dziś i jutro nie będzie padać.
Obrazek
Ostatnio zmieniony piątek 12 lut 2016, 14:06 przez Spenser, łącznie zmieniany 1 raz.
ODPOWIEDZ